隐私政策

WhatsApp API,实现跨平台通讯应用开发的强大工具

WhatsApp2025-05-26 20:11:177
WhatsApp API为开发者提供了一个强大的桥梁,使他们能够轻松地在多种平台上创建和管理跨平台通讯应用,通过使用WhatsApp API,开发者可以访问WhatsApp的丰富功能库,如消息发送、接收、群组管理和好友关系处理等,API还提供了丰富的数据接口,使得开发人员可以在他们的应用程序中集成实时通信的功能。,借助WhatsApp API,开发者无需深入了解WhatsApp内部的工作原理即可快速构建具有强大功能的移动应用,这些应用不仅支持文本消息,还可以包括多媒体文件分享、视频通话以及更多的高级特性,这使得WhatsApp API成为跨平台通讯应用开发的理想选择,尤其适用于需要高度个性化用户体验的现代企业级应用。

说明: 本文将详细介绍WhatsApp API的作用及其在构建跨平台通讯应用中的重要性,我们将深入探讨WhatsApp API是如何简化开发者的工作流程,并为何被众多开发者视为理想的选择。


WhatsApp API简介

WhatsApp API 是一个开源接口,它为开发者提供了强大的工具,让他们能够在各种平台上轻松创建和管理与WhatsApp相关的应用程序,通过利用WhatsApp API,开发人员能够实现实时的消息发送、接收、群组管理以及用户互动等功能,而无需从头开始搭建底层通信基础设施。


WhatsApp API的特点

  • 多语言支持: WhatsApp API 支持多种编程语言和框架,如 Python、Java 和 JavaScript 等。
  • 易于集成: 使用简单的 API 方法即可完成开发工作,大大降低了开发成本和时间。
  • 广泛的用户基础: WhatsApp 具有庞大的用户群体,这为开发者提供了广阔的市场空间。

WhatsApp API的使用示例

假设我们要创建一款基于 WhatsApp 功能的跨平台聊天应用:

  1. 注册并获取 App ID

    • 注册 WhatsApp 开发者账户,并创建新的应用。
    • 获取应用 ID 和密钥。
  2. 安装并配置 SDK

    • 下载适合 iOS 或 Android 平台的 WhatsApp SDK。
    • 安装 SDK 到项目中,并按照文档进行配置。
  3. 设置 API 密钥

    根据应用类型填写相应的 API 密钥。

  4. 初始化 API 客户端

    • 使用 SDK 提供的方法初始化 API 客户端,initClient 函数。
  5. 发起 API 请求

    • 发送 HTTP 请求到 WhatsApp API,例如使用 postRequest 方法。
  6. 处理响应

    解析 API 返回的数据,并将其展示给用户。

  7. 错误处理和日志记录

    监控 API 请求结果,以便在出现问题时及时发现并修复。


API对接步骤概述

以下是 WhatsApp API 连接的主要步骤:

  1. 注册并获取 App ID

    创建新的 WhatsApp 应用,并获得 App ID 和密钥。

  2. 安装并配置 SDK

    下载 SDK 并安装到项目中。

  3. 设置 API 密钥

    填写正确的 API 密钥。

  4. 初始化 API 客户端

    调用 SDK 中的初始化方法。

  5. 发起 API 请求

    使用 HTTP 请求发起 API 请求。

  6. 处理响应

    解析 API 返回的数据。

  7. 错误处理和日志记录

    检查 API 请求结果,并记录关键事件。


常见应用场景

  1. 聊天应用

    集成 WhatsApp 功能,让用户可以通过应用直接与 WhatsApp 友好友互动。

  2. 群聊管理

    提供强大的群聊管理功能,如添加成员、删除成员、设置权限等。

  3. 多媒体共享

    允许用户上传和分享图片、视频、音频等多媒体文件。

  4. 即时通知

    实时推送新消息通知,提升用户体验。


注意事项与挑战

尽管 WhatsApp API 给开发者带来了许多便利,但同时也有一些需要注意的问题:

  • 安全性问题: 确保所有 API 请求都经过加密传输,以防止数据泄露。
  • 性能优化: 考虑用户并发数,合理分配服务器资源,避免因负载过高导致的服务中断。
  • 合规性: 了解当地法律法规,尤其是在隐私保护和数据安全方面。
  • 技术支持: 定期检查和更新 SDK 版本,保证技术栈的安全性和稳定性。

通过 WhatsApp API,开发者能够快速接入成熟的 WhatsApp 通讯能力,同时结合其庞大用户基础和广泛的社交影响力,打造出具备竞争力的产品,随着技术的发展和应用创新,WhatsApp API 将继续作为构建高质量通讯应用的强大工具,助力企业和个人实现更好的沟通体验。

本文链接:https://www.ccsng.com/news/post/47958.html

跨平台API通讯应用开发WhatsAppAPI对接

阅读更多

相关文章